Heart of Italy, nestled in the southeast part of Chicago, is a vibrant neighborhood bursting with charm and culture that makes it a fantastic place to call home. Known for its strong Italian heritage, the area offers a warm community feel with plenty of family-owned restaurants, quaint cafes, and local bakeries that serve up authentic Italian dishes and pastries. Residents and visitors alike enjoy the lively atmosphere, especially during seasonal festivals that celebrate the neighborhood’s rich cultural roots. If you’re a fan of fresh pasta, espresso, and traditional Italian treats, this neighborhood is sure to make you feel right at home.
